Uvulectomy is a surgical procedure that involves the removal of the uvula, the small, teardrop-shaped piece of tissue that hangs down at the back of the throat. This procedure is often performed for various medical reasons, most notably for chronic conditions such as snoring or obstructive sleep apnea, where the uvula can contribute to airway obstruction during sleep. Patients suffering from severe cases of these conditions may find relief through uvulectomy, as removing the uvula can help reduce tissue interference in the throat, thus improving airflow and significantly decreasing snoring. Another common indication for this surgery is the presence of uvular hypertrophy, a condition characterized by an enlarged uvula that can lead to persistent throat discomfort, difficulty swallowing, and may even contribute to a gag reflex. Furthermore, recurrent episodes of uvulitis, which is the inflammation of the uvula, may necessitate this surgical intervention when conservative treatments fail. Sometimes, individuals may undergo uvulectomy as part of a broader surgical approach to treat other conditions requiring throat surgery. Though uvulectomy can provide many benefits, it is essential for patients to understand the potential risks involved. These may include infection, bleeding, or adverse reactions to anesthesia. Post-operative recovery typically involves managing swelling and discomfort, which can be alleviated with pain medications and a soft diet. Patients are usually advised to avoid spicy or acidic foods for a specified period. In some cases, individuals may experience a change in their voice or difficulties in swallowing, although these effects are generally temporary. For individuals considering uvulectomy, it is crucial to consult with an otorhinolaryngologist or a specialist in throat disorders, as they can evaluate the specific symptoms and medical history to determine if this procedure is appropriate. Beyond its therapeutic applications, it's also important for patients to understand that the uvula does play a role in various functions, such as producing saliva and aiding in speech, so the decision to undergo this procedure should be made judiciously. The overall success rate of uvulectomy is high, with many patients reporting significant improvements in their quality of life following the procedure. They often notice a reduction in nighttime disturbances, more restful sleep, and overall better health outcomes.
